Abstract

The invention provides a digestive endoscope foreign body measurement system and a digestive endoscope foreign body measurement method. A measurement unit and a control unit of the measurement system can be integrated in an existing digestive endoscope; when medical personnel perform routine diagnosis and treatment by virtue of the digestive endoscope, a projection unit of the measurement system can directly project on a foreign body in digestive tract if the foreign body exists, and a display unit can display the size and dimension of the foreign body clearly, so as to reduce the possibility of misdiagnosis and to bring more benefits for the determination of treatment means on patients in the next step, which is conducive to building a good doctor-patient relationship.

Background technology
Known, digestive endoscopy treatment is conventional diagnosis and treatment means, is developed so far, can not only observes the situation of inside, people digest road, also have multiple treatment means concurrently, as polypectomy, stentplacement etc.When finding the foreign body needing excision or operation in digestive endoscopy diagnosis and treatment, the very first time measure the size of foreign body, shape is vital.But in current diagnosis and treatment process, the judgement for foreign body size often will rely on the experience of operator, or rely on foreign body image shown on display screen to estimate, accuracy is not high.Therefore the more intuitive and accurate measuring method of one is needed, can in the size of the very first time displaying foreign body in alimentary tract of digestive endoscopy checking process and shape.

Detailed description of the invention
Below by embodiment, and by reference to the accompanying drawings, technical scheme of the present invention is described in further detail.
A kind of digestive endoscopy foreign body measuring system, comprising: measuring unit, control unit, display unit and projecting cell; Described control unit is connected with measuring unit, display unit and projecting cell respectively.
Described measuring unit and control unit are integrated in digestive endoscopy.
Wherein measuring unit selects the existing device (namely existing digestive endoscopy has this functional unit) with image collecting function;
A kind of digestive endoscopy foreign body measuring method, comprises the steps;
Step 1: digestive endoscopy is put into digestive tract;
Step 2: measuring unit measures foreign body, and imports the image information of foreign body in alimentary tract into control unit;
Step: 3: control unit receives the image information that measuring unit sends, and image information is sent in display unit and projecting cell;
Step 4: display unit by the image information display that receives on a display screen;
Step 5: projecting cell receives image information, and zooms in or out image information;
Step 6: display unit zoomed in or out by projecting cell the proportion measurement of image information survey the size of foreign body.
In described step 5: projecting cell receives the image information of foreign body in alimentary tract, according to the image projecting of square lattice coordinate line, zoom in or out image information.
In described step 6 display unit according to the number of projection unit projects square lattice measure survey the size of foreign body.
During operation, the number that medical personnel can account for projection grid by foreign body on the display unit directly reads the size of surveyed foreign body, and shape is also very clear.Medical personnel also can by other means proportion measurement survey the size of foreign body.
